DucAle
Birra del Borgo in Borgorose (RI), Lazio, Italy 🇮🇹
Belgian Style - Strong Ale Regular|
Score
6.56
|
|
Inspired by Strong Belgian Ales, it’s rather dark in color with ruby glares, it forms a firm frothy head and entices with its rich and complex aromas in which the warm and boozy notes are softened by the nutty ones. It’s round and sweet on the palate, with a big body, it has a long finish that leads to cocoa and roasty notes.

Bottled@Monks Cafe Wallingatan, Stockholm. Murky reddish brown colour with small pale beige head. Aroma is sweet malts, some fruity and floral notes along with mild burnt sugary sweetness as well. Flavour is sweet malts, mild burnt sugary sweeetness, some yeast and mild notes of nuttyness. As it warms up also some alcohol comes through.

Bottled. A hazy dark amber beer with a thin beige head. The aroma is sweet yet with an acidic edge and notes of caramel, fruit, spices and vegetables. The flavor is sweet malty with notes of caramel, brown sugar, spices, fruit, and some berries, leading to a dry end - the alcohol dries out the tongue.
